3,4-BIS(1-METHYLETHYL)-BENZENAMINE

Base Information Edit
  • Chemical Name:3,4-BIS(1-METHYLETHYL)-BENZENAMINE
  • CAS No.:116233-13-7
  • Molecular Formula:C12H19 N
  • Molecular Weight:177.29
  • Hs Code.:
  • Mol file:116233-13-7.mol
3,4-BIS(1-METHYLETHYL)-BENZENAMINE

Synonyms:3,4-Diisopropylaniline

synthetic route:
Guidance literature:
With hydrogen; palladium on activated charcoal; In ethanol;
DOI:10.1021/jm00119a021
Guidance literature:
Multi-step reaction with 2 steps
1: 81.6 percent / HNO3, H2SO4 / acetic acid
2: 83 percent / hydrogen / Pd/C / ethanol
With sulfuric acid; hydrogen; nitric acid; palladium on activated charcoal; In ethanol; acetic acid;
DOI:10.1021/jm00119a021
